Man arrested for grand larceny, threatening language
An Arlington man was arrested for stealing X-rays from a dentist's office and then berating the investigating police officer on the telephone. On July 2 at 6:10 p.m., the victim told police that the suspect had taken X-rays and other paperwork from the office of Dr. Charles Kirksey, 10777 Main St. in Fairfax City, without permission.The officer then called the suspect “and was verbally assaulted on the telephone,” police said.
The following day at 9:30 p.m., Kevin Lam, 51, of 521 South Lancaster St., was arrested and charged with grand larceny and using “profane, threatening language over the telephone,” police said. Bond was set at $2,000.
